[0026] Example 1

[0027] A method for growing wild jujube in saline-alkali land, which comprises the following steps:

[0028] S1. Obtaining seedlings: using wild jujube seeds to cultivate seedlings of the species needed for grafting, and the seedlings are cultivated in the seedbed for later use;

[0029] S2. Site selection and soil preparation: first deep plough 50cm, apply appropriate amount of soil improvement fertilizer, and mix it with the digging soil evenly, and level the ground; the planting point is 1m×1m deep and 35cm deep for planting ditch; the soil improvement fertilizer is in parts by mass The raw material formula is as follows: 120 parts of crop waste slurry, 400 parts of decomposed manure, 160 parts of nano carbon, 120 parts of Scenedesmus obliquus decomposing agent, 80 parts of tea residue, 60 parts of EDTA-Zn, 20 parts of Azotobacter Parts, 1200 parts of water, 14 parts of microbial fermentation agent;

Abstract

The invention discloses a method for planting ziziphus jujuba in a saline-alkali land. The method comprises the following steps: S1, seedlings are obtained, wherein ziziphus jujuba seeds are used for cultivating rootstock seedlings for grafting seedlings of needed varieties, and the obtained seedlings are cultivated in a seedbed for later use; S2, land selection and land preparation are carried out; S3, transplanting is carried out; S4, fertilizer and water management is carried out, and S5, pruning and trimming are carried out. According to the method for planting ziziphus jujuba in the saline-alkali land, before ziziphus jujuba tree planting, planting soil is fertilized, such that the fertility of the planting soil is effectively improved, and the environment of the saline-alkali land is ameliorated. A good condition is provided for the healthy growth of planted ziziphus jujuba trees. During a ziziphus jujuba tree growth period, pests and diseases are reduced, fertilizer dose is reduced, and pesticide uses are less. Ziziphus jujuba tree planting cost is reduced, and pesticide pollution to the environment is reduced.

technical field [0001] The invention relates to a method for planting jujube in saline-alkali land. Background technique [0002] Saline-alkali soil is a general term for saline soil, alkaline soil and various salinized and alkalized soils. Saline soil refers to the soil in which the soluble salt content in the soil reaches a certain level, which can cause obvious harm to the growth and development of plants. Alkaline soil refers to the soil that contains a large amount of exchangeable ions in the soil, and the amount reaches the level that can harm the growth and development of plants and change the soil properties. In actual conditions, saline soil and alkaline soil often coexist in a mixed manner, collectively referred to as saline-alkali soil.
